Why Do You Need A Responsive Website?
Looking for Responsive website Designing?
Nowadays we come across many website development and design business that assure the user to use latest technologies and provide best responsive website designs.
But if you are a non-technical person then you must be wondering what do you mean by responsive website?
When we look for Device friendly website or a site to work on any device, again we see this "Responsive" word appearing!
So, in this article I would try and answer this question in a simple way so that anyone who reads this article can understand this and be able to relate to it.
With the advancement of technologies and coming up of smart phones, tablets we have changed our way of gathering information, networking with people and the way we use the internet. Internet, the World Wide Web has become a necessity and we search for many things on and off all around the day. We access internet through our mobile phones, tabs, laptops and desktops. Another medium smart watches is also becoming popular. Even in our phones we have variety of screen sizes 4.5 inches, 5 inches, 6 inches etc and many operating systems IOS, Android, Windows all with different software versions and user interfaces.
Now we want to access a webpage using any devices. A responsive website is the only one that adjusts itself with the changing gadgets and therefore enhances the user experience. We can see the same content without the need of zoom in or out adjusting device screens to view a particular page on the net. The coding of the site is such that it adjusts itself with the dimensions of the interfaces used by user.
We do and make the website responsive by the parse of both Internet marketing and designing. The view port meta-tag is used for the same and gives a user a trouble-free experience of opening the URL for his or her desired appliance.
